Specification
6ES7521-1BL00-0AB0 is a DI 32x24VDC HF digital input module for SIMATIC S7-1500 SM 521. It has a 32-channel design, each 16 channels are a group, 2 dedicated high-speed counter channels, supports up to 6kHz frequency counting, and the minimum input delay is only 0.05ms.

FAQ:
1. What is the wiring method of 6ES7521-1BL00-0AB0?
- Adapted to a 40-pin front connector (screw type 6ES7590-1AE80-0AA0 / plug-in type 6ES7590-1AF30-0AA0), 32 channels are divided into 2 groups (16 channels each), each group has an independent common terminal, and supports sink/source universal wiring.
- Terminal assignment: 1-16 = channels 0-15 (first group), 21-36 = channels 16-31 (second group); 19 = first group L+, 20 = first group M; 29 = second group L+, 40 = second group M; the rest are reserved terminals.
- Power connection: The two groups can be powered independently (19/20 is connected to power supply 1, 29/40 is connected to power supply 2), or 19-29 and 20-40 can be short-circuited to achieve shared power supply.
- Signal wiring: source type (sensor + is connected to the channel terminal, sensor – is connected to M of this group); sink type (sensor + is connected to L+ of this group, sensor – is connected to the channel terminal).
- High-speed counting: Channel 0 (terminal 1) and 1 (terminal 2) are counting channels, connected to the first group of common terminals, up to 6kHz.
- Key notes: Wiring should be well shielded to resist interference; inductive loads should be equipped with surge suppressors; hot plugging should cut off the load power supply first; the maximum current of each common terminal should be 20mA.
2.What is the maximum input frequency supported by 6ES7521-1BL00-0AB0?
- Ordinary digital input: related to the input delay. When the minimum delay is 0.05ms, the theoretical maximum is about 10kHz (actually affected by module filtering and interference, it is usually designed to be stable at 5kHz).
- High-speed counting channel (channel 0/1): supports up to 6kHz (32-bit counting), the counting mode needs to be configured in the TIA Portal, and is only adapted to the first group of common power supplies.
